"Stroud’s first Walking Festival will take place this September, 2007, from Saturday the 8th until Sunday the 16th.

It has been organised by Stroud Town Council in partnership with a host of local environmental and educational groups and organisations. They hope to build the festival into a major annual event.

Over a dozen walks have been organised this year. Each walk will be led by a trained guide, with knowledge of their respective routes. They all take place in or close to Stroud"
